If possible, see if you can solicit some unbiased opinions concerning your selections for your domains. Getting perspectives from people not directly involved is always a good thing to do. Besides this, if you’ve got an existing list of prospects/customers, you can email them and ask for their feedback. It is normal for people to look at things differently from one another, and that is what this is all about. Be sure you have some solid reasoning for considering your domain. All you want to do is get some second opinions, that’s all.

You may see names with big price tags, and if you can buy them that is great – but realize you do not have to. Just take a look at the pros and cons of buying an existing name versus one that is totally new. So just think about the money you spend on a domain that could be put to better use.
Every website has the potential to become a brand in the future; if you want to strike it big with your site, then selecting a domain name that’s easily brandable is important. Everything totally change, and you actually have a lot more creative room with a domain you are going to brand. Take your cues from the market you are working with because they have to accept it and not you. Put yourself in the shoes of your prospects and see what you can come up with.
